Yes, you are right, Moxinax is a generic form of Xanax. Alprazolam is the generic common drug name. This is a benzodiazepam. It will cause you to sleep, but unfortunately it deprives the user of REM sleep. REM is the phase of sleep that allows the brain to recharge and refresh yourself.
It is not recommended to be used for long periods of time.
The reason why the pharmacists were looking at you strange is that alprazolam is a control drug - so usually can only be obtained by prescription from a hospital, or a pharmacy that has a permit to dispense control drugs. |
